A four run ninth propelled the Pulaski Yankees to a 4- 2 tonight at Burlington Athletic Stadium over the Royals. 
In a game dominated by pitching through seven innings, the Burlington Royals would score twice in the eighth to break the deadlock. 
Jake Means' single to right highlighted the Royals scoring in the frame. Maikel Garcia would plate on the safety, as Vinnie Pasquantino followed him on a throwing error. 
Garcia would lead the offense for Burlington with three knocks, including a triple and his league leading 19th steal of 2019. 
Mitch Spence would pick up the win for the Yankees to improve to 2-3 on the year. Jonah DiPoto was tagged with the loss to go to 1-2 in 2019. 
The win for Pulaski moves their division magic to one in the Appalachian League East division.
